We port the concept of non-Markovian quantum dynamics to the many-particle realm, by a suitable decomposition of the many-particle Hilbert space. We show how the specific structure of many-particle states determines the observability of non-Markovianity by single- or many-particle observables, and discuss a realization in a readily implementable few-particle set-up.
